0. Technology Vision
Description: In terms of technology, what are we pursuing?
1.Documentation
- Path to Production
- golive and release diary
- other wikis and documentation
Description: The document is the code - a good documentation should be versionable.
2.Architecture
- system architecture diagram, such as C4Model mode
- existing technology stacks and their relationships
3.Code base
- construction guide
- architecture decision record
- editor configuration and code style specification
- mode and style guide
4.Project Evolution
- future technology stack
- system evolution plan
1.Path to Development
- development machine and network permission preparation and so on
- code repositroy permission management
- editor and related tool application setup
Note: different organizations have their own special situations, such as the opening of PC ports, network permissions, codebase permissions, etc., which require a certain process.
2.Path to Production
- the process of golive's every step
- related key people
- the tools needed for each step
- the process required for each step
Note: Path to Production in the code is just a description - for developers, and here's a more detailed explanation.
3.Path to Roll Off Note: What do you need when you change a project?
1.Teammate
- Who are you looking for each problem?
- Team members' technical stack and level
- How to bring everyone's skill level: Coach, Pairing, Tech
- Project-independent technology, who can find "entertainment" together?
- 1 to 1 Meetings
2.Stakeholders
- Learn about each stakeholder (Level 1). As a developer, most of the time there is no direct communication with stakeholders.
- Stay in communication with the stakeholders (Level 2). Proper communication can help the project to work better.
3.Cross-team collaboration
- What are the relevant partners and who are the respective interfaces?
0.Business Vision
Explanation: What are we doing, where are we going?
1.Business
- Is there a list of requirements that are close to full? At a certain time (such as iterations), the demand should be stable.
- How does demand go from verbal to to-do list? Is there an irregular problem in the middle?
- How is the business changed?
2.Cross-functional requirements
- Operational quality. Quality observed during system operation, such as security and ease of use
- Evolution quality. Software system structure and quality related to the development process, such as software testability, maintainability, scalability, scalability, etc.
